In this context it probably just means the physicians'/midwives' ability to assert one's will. The sample comes from a text on medical simulation in obstetrics:
"The obstetric simulation course was lengthened to 6 hours to accommodate 3 scenarios and provide adequate time to debrief all issues of concern to participants. The 6-hour session allowed clinicians to attend personal or clinical obligations during the late afternoon or evening hours. The third scenario was designed to unfold slowly throughout the day thus providing a sense of passing time and highlighting issues related to long-term vigilance and assertion."

assertività / asserzione / affermazione di sé
L'assertività (dal latino "asserere" che significa "asserire"), o asserzione (o anche affermazione di sé), è una caratteristica del comportamento umano che consiste nella capacità di esprimere in modo chiaro ed efficace le proprie emozioni e opinioni.
... si definisce come un comportamento che permette a una persona di agire nel suo pieno interesse, di difendere il suo punto di vista senza ansia esagerata, di esprimere con sincerità e disinvoltura i propri sentimenti e di difendere i suoi diritti senza ignorare quelli altrui.
(da Wikipedia)
